dc.description.abstractRadio Frequency Identification (RFID), one of the key technologies of silent commerce has been gaining momentum over the past couple of years. It is an automated data-capture technology that can be used to electronically identify, track, and store information contained on an RFID tag. The RFID tag could be attached to or embedded in an object, such as a product, case, or pallet. Recently, market has clap eye on UHF RFID technology to take advantage in long range identity identification. In this thesis, projects access and inventory control have been created and discussed. A few samples have been taken in evaluation process of the projects. The results are very encouraging; with 100% of RFID tags identified after adjustment of antennas power. This has proved that implementation of the projects is much recommended, for convenient in our campus.
